What is the role of the Council for Citizen Participation and Social Control in the Ecuadorian judicial system?
The Citizen Participation and Social Control Council has the mandate to promote citizen participation and supervise public management. In the judicial sphere, this council can intervene in the appointment and dismissal of certain officials, contributing to transparency and accountability.

What is the process to request a land use permit in Ecuador?
The process to request a land use permit in Ecuador involves going to the Municipality corresponding to the area where the land is located. You must submit an application and provide detailed information about the type of use the land will be used for, such as residential, commercial or industrial. In addition, you must comply with the requirements established by municipal regulations, such as technical studies, plans and other specific documents. The Municipality will evaluate the application and, if approved, the land use permit will be issued.
How has identity validation evolved in the context of electronic commerce in Colombia in recent years?
In recent years, identity validation in e-commerce in Colombia has evolved through the adoption of more advanced technologies. Biometric authentication solutions, more sophisticated document verification systems and faster authentication methods have been implemented to improve user experience and strengthen security in online transactions.
How are the risks associated with corruption and bribery in business operations in Bolivia addressed during due diligence?
Addressing risks involves implementing anti-corruption policies, conducting thorough investigations and fostering an ethical culture. Conducting due diligence on business partners, establishing rigorous internal controls, and training employees on ethical practices are essential steps to prevent and address risks of corruption and bribery in business operations in Bolivia.
How is equal opportunity for small and medium-sized companies ensured in bidding processes in Ecuador?
Equality of opportunities for small and medium-sized companies in bidding processes in Ecuador is ensured through the implementation of policies that favor the participation of this type of companies, the simplification of bidding requirements, and the creation of specific categories that promote competition fair This seeks to balance opportunities and support the development of smaller businesses.
